Labeling Experience

UBER AI - Data Annotator

VideoEvaluation Rating
In my role at Uber AI, I used the Data Compute platform to label and evaluate video data by comparing generated outputs against original input videos. I assessed key attributes such as motion consistency, ensuring movements were natural and aligned with the source material, as well as identifying any discrepancies in visual continuity. I also evaluated sensitive attributes such as race and gender representation, carefully checking for unintended changes or inconsistencies between the input and output videos. This required a high level of attention to detail, strong analytical skills, and strict adherence to evaluation guidelines. My work contributed to improving the fairness, accuracy, and overall quality of AI-generated video outputs.

UBER AI-Transcriptionist

AudioTranscription
In my role at Uber AI as a Transcriptionist, I was responsible for generating verbatim transcripts from English audio files with a high level of accuracy and attention to detail. I carefully listened to recordings and converted spoken content into precise written text, capturing speech exactly as delivered, including pauses, filler words, and variations in tone where required by guidelines. This role required strong listening skills, excellent command of English, and the ability to handle different accents, audio qualities, and speaking speeds. I consistently followed transcription standards and formatting guidelines to ensure clarity and consistency, contributing to the development of high-quality datasets used for training and improving AI language models.

Imerit -Ai Data Annotator

ImageEvaluation Rating
In my role as an AI Data Annotator at iMerit, I was responsible for evaluating images generated by AI systems to ensure they met quality and realism standards. I carefully reviewed each image, identifying common AI-generated flaws such as unnatural lighting, visual distortions, inconsistencies in textures, and structural inaccuracies. Based on these observations, I flagged low-quality outputs and categorized them according to predefined guidelines, helping improve the overall performance and reliability of the AI models. This role required strong attention to detail, visual analysis skills, and the ability to consistently apply annotation standards across large datasets. My work directly contributed to refining image generation models by ensuring only high-quality, accurate data was used for training and evaluation.
